The Bride Who Said No: Escaping the Shadows of Yesterday novel Chapter 149

"Got it." With a glance at the notification on his phone, Ronan quickly texted Freya.

Ronan: [It's all set.]

Freya read Ronan's message, a slight smirk forming on her lips.

This time, Johanna was in for a rude awakening. Word had spread like wildfire. Thanks to Johanna, the Dawson family had booked the grand ballroom at the Majestic Manor Hotel. She had been quite reluctant when it came to footing the bill.

But armed with this token of status, Johanna couldn't stop boasting over the phone, as if afraid someone might miss the news about her booking the grandest hall at the Majestic Manor Hotel.

After school, Freya made a detour straight back to the Dawson family.

As soon as she walked in, she could hear Johanna on the phone, extending invites to the high society ladies for the upcoming party. "Mrs. Brown, my son's birthday bash is at the Majestic Manor Hotel. I've booked the grandest ballroom they have. You must come and grace us with your presence!"

Freya listened silently to Johanna's conversation, laughing coldly to herself. 'Enjoy your moment now. On the day of the banquet, your laughter will end.'

Johanna had noticed Freya's return and promptly ended her call.

Looking displeased, Johanna asked, "Why are you back?"

Freya retorted, "This is my home. Why can’t I come back?"

"Why are you panicking, Johanna? The Dawson Group has nothing to do with you anymore. Even if the company runs out of money or goes bankrupt, it doesn't seem it would affect you."

Johanna felt a tightness in her chest when Freya mentioned it. She couldn't forget how Freya had exposed her and Galen's misdeeds at the company, making her the laughingstock.

She had lost all face to show up at the company.

Yet, undeterred, Johanna claimed, "Even if the company doesn't concern me, I'm still your mother. I have to look out for you! Can't you appreciate the good intentions of others?"

Freya laughed it off, aware Johanna's sudden concern for the company was merely her scheming to regain control once Freya was married off.
